Do not hire this company.

According to a neighbor who engaged them, a project that should have taken  - at most - five days, ended up taking close to nine weeks. This landscaper provided excuse after excuse as to why they couldn't finish the job within the original time frame estimate. The landscaper kept leaving the job to go and work on other projects, leaving my neighbor's job unfinished for weeks.

Even though the job was simple and my neighbors knew exactly what they wanted and were clear about this, the landscaper repeatedly tried to push our neighbor into the landscaper's plant and design choices. The landscaper isn't as knowledgeable as they claim and had to redo one section of my neighbor's project three times as they failed to complete it properly on the first two attempts.

Even worse, my neighbor discovered that the landscaper's contractor's license expired during the time they were to complete the job and my neighbor had to bar them from entering the yard and doing more work until this situation was cleared up and the license was reinstated.

Finally, the landscaper damaged plants, grass and the sprinkler system while completing work and refused to replace and/or fix these items.

All in all, my neighbor told me it was pretty much a headache dealing with these people and the final work product was mediocre at best.

There are far too many reputable and conscientious landscapers out there to deal with a company that performs work in this manner.
